Vibrantly Toned 1948 Quarter, MS67+
1948 25C MS67+ PCGS Secure. CAC. Iridescent toning in shades of lime-green, bright yellow, fuchsia, and deep purple envelops the obverse of this high-end Superb Gem. An area with similar shades frames approximately half of the reverse periphery. A die crack extends almost the entire length of the eagle's right wing along the outer edge. Population: 74 in 67 (3 in 67+), 1 finer (11/12).From The David Poole Collection of Silver Washington Quarters.(Registry values: N208)
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 245L, PCGS# 5836, Greysheet# 5629)
Weight: 6.25 grams
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
